Can Tree Roots really break through concrete?
Concrete is a strong and tough material. However it isn’t immune to the force of the roots of trees. If the roots of the tree are left unchecked they may expand and expand, and then push on the top of the concrete, creating chips, cracks, or even a full-blown break. This can be risky for pedestrians and pedestrians, but be an extremely dangerous hazard to the structure of concrete.
What’s the cause behind the roots of trees to harm concrete?
There are many factors that can cause damage to tree roots. This includes:
- Conditions of the soil The soil’s condition is not well-drained or compacted or lacks drainage, tree roots might be forced upwards to look for water. This could increase pressure on the concrete’s surface.
- The tree species Some kinds of tree species are much more agressive than others when it comes to the growth of their roots. For instance, willow trees are well-known for their extensive root systems, while oak trees are sturdy and have deep roots, which could result in severe damage to concrete structures.
- The age of the tree: The old a tree gets, the larger its root system becomes and this increases the danger for destruction for concrete constructions.

Can tree roots lead to damages to underground pipes?
Yes , tree roots could cause major damages to pipes underground as they search for the water as well as nutrients. This could lead to blocks or leaks, which could lead to complete failure of the pipes.

Concrete can be repaired after the damage caused by tree roots?
Concrete is able to be repaired after damage to the roots of trees, however it is essential to determine the cause of the problem to avoid it from occurring another time at a later time. This might mean removing the tree or making changes to the soil’s conditions to allow for the proper growth that of the roots.
